Unmanned system forces reported on the results of strikes on Russian oil refineries
In the Forces of Ukraine's unmanned systems, the results of the operation against oil refineries and pipelines on the territory of the Russian Federation were summarized. During the week, at least 4 targets were hit.

This was reported by the commander of the Ukrainian Armed Forces' Unmanned Systems Forces, Robert "Madjar" Brovdi, on his Telegram page.

According to him, over the past seven days during the operation "Ruszkik Gaza," Ukrainian drones have struck at least four major targets:

  • August 14 – Lukoil Volgograd Oil Refinery, reported to have ceased operations.
  • August 18 – "Druzhba" oil pumping station in Nikolskoye, Tambov region. The Russians claimed to have restored it within 48 hours, but there is no confirmation of its launch.
  • August 20 – Novoshakhtinsk Oil Refinery in the Rostov region. The fire there has been ongoing for over 60 hours and as of August 23, continues to expand.
  • August 21 – another station on the "Druzhba" pipeline in Unecha, Bryansk region. Reports indicate the facility was extensively on fire, and it was promised to be restored within 5 days.
